CrawlJobs Logo
Briefcase Icon
Category Icon

Filters

×

Senior C# .NET Developer Jobs

2 Job Offers

Filters
Senior C# .NET Developer
Save Icon
Seeking a Senior C# .NET Developer and Solution Architect in Des Moines, Iowa. You will design scalable cloud architecture for financial trading platforms, integrating 3rd party APIs and vendor solutions. This direct-hire role offers a $150K base, 15% bonus, comprehensive benefits, and a unique 2...
Location Icon
Location
United States , Des Moines, Iowa
Salary Icon
Salary
150000.00 USD / Year
https://www.roberthalf.com Logo
Robert Half
Expiration Date
Until further notice
Senior Software Developer .NET / C#
Save Icon
Seeking a UK-based Senior .NET/C# Developer for a 6-month remote contract. Leverage your expertise in Azure, event-driven architecture, and modern .NET to design and lead development on key software systems. This role offers technical leadership growth, a competitive package, and comprehensive be...
Location Icon
Location
United Kingdom
Salary Icon
Salary
60000.00 GBP / Year
jobs.360resourcing.co.uk Logo
360 Resourcing Solutions
Expiration Date
Until further notice
Discover rewarding Senior C# .NET Developer jobs, a pivotal role at the heart of modern software engineering. These seasoned professionals are the architects and builders of robust, scalable applications using the Microsoft technology stack. Far more than just coding, a Senior C# .NET Developer is responsible for the entire software development lifecycle of complex systems, from conceptual design and technical specification through to implementation, deployment, and ongoing optimization. They translate business requirements into elegant technical solutions, ensuring performance, security, and maintainability. Typical responsibilities for these senior roles involve designing and developing high-quality software using C#, .NET Core/.NET 5+, and associated frameworks like ASP.NET. They create and maintain APIs (RESTful, GraphQL) for seamless integration between services and third-party systems. A significant part of their day is dedicated to writing clean, testable code, conducting code reviews, and mentoring mid-level and junior developers to elevate the entire team's expertise. They are deeply involved in architectural decision-making, selecting appropriate patterns and technologies to build future-proof solutions. With the industry's shift to the cloud, they commonly build and deploy applications on platforms like Microsoft Azure or AWS, utilizing services for compute, databases, and serverless functions, often within containerized environments using Docker and orchestration tools like Kubernetes. The typical skill set for Senior C# .NET Developer jobs is extensive. Mastery of C# and the .NET ecosystem is fundamental, complemented by strong knowledge of object-oriented design principles, SOLID principles, and architectural patterns (e.g., Microservices, MVC, Domain-Driven Design). Proficiency with databases, both SQL (SQL Server, PostgreSQL) and NoSQL, is essential, as is experience with ORM tools like Entity Framework Core. Familiarity with front-end technologies (JavaScript, TypeScript, React, Angular, or Blazor) is often required for full-stack capabilities. Key non-technical requirements include excellent problem-solving abilities, strong communication skills to collaborate with cross-functional teams and stakeholders, and a proven track record of leading technical initiatives. Employers typically seek candidates with 5+ years of dedicated .NET development experience, a history of working on enterprise-level applications, and a passion for continuous learning in a rapidly evolving field. Explore Senior C# .NET Developer jobs to find a career where you can design the backbone of critical business applications and lead the next wave of digital innovation.

Filters

×
Countries
Category
Location
Work Mode
Salary